Site progress at Bartlett Park

After some months of site closure, it has been exciting to see landscape works underway once more at Bartlett Park in LB Tower Hamlets. Despite current slightly arid conditions and temporary fencing, bedded plants and trees are looking healthy and the sowed wildflower seeds are now in full colour.

Canal side footings are going in, ready for stepped granite block seating, ramp and access steps – a complete overhaul to a newly pedestrianised Cotall Street and integrated Limehouse Cut canal towpath. This area of the park in particular will become a focus of activity based on the relationship between the wider park, existing Poplar Union Café, flagship inclusive playground, pedestrianised street and Limehouse Cut Canal. Activities here include a new pontoon for kayaking, proposed market stalls and talk of a floating cinema screen on canal boat viewed from the new granite block seating down to the canal.

Pending works include completion of Cotall Street and canal side, the installation of a new pre-fab changing room for the football pitches and a ‘phase 4’ adventure play area and natural education space.
